Output 6dce7e83b7344444b576295d12737fa028f4e5e391a51fd6aa53a4ba3df45ae9:27

value
1110400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e10af0a37bed2b4820b0d0b7001fc39eda1a4a OP_EQUAL
address
3MTmUDrWFEc6MxFnJF9LqTVq8xSsugYPna
transaction
6dce7e83b7344444b576295d12737fa028f4e5e391a51fd6aa53a4ba3df45ae9
spent
true